Transaction 03642ad61f8ecb53ab1733c21b3ce352b46a541a3a8e7e0d80419d9dcbbb6bed
1 Input
2 Outputs
- 03642ad61f8ecb53ab1733c21b3ce352b46a541a3a8e7e0d80419d9dcbbb6bed:0
- 03642ad61f8ecb53ab1733c21b3ce352b46a541a3a8e7e0d80419d9dcbbb6bed:1
value 487616
address 1BwkSPW4Xrs7Q1W5jrMt6dji16o9AFgs4F
value 36224904
address 3HMqVomsHirpFrPhy14AcCopLps4zomj6N